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 5.00/13: Рейтинг темы: голосов - 13, средняя оценка - 5.00
104 / 15 / 3
Регистрация: 29.11.2010
Сообщений: 335
1

Не могу открыть файл через argv[]

04.12.2014, 22:45. Показов 2564. Ответов 2
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Есть у меня
C++
1
2
3
4
5
int main(int argc, char *argv[])
{
    std::ifstream In(argv[1]);
///....
}
Через отладчик подаю 123 (у меня во всех папках проекта лежит 123.txt):
Не могу открыть файл через argv[]

В 123.txt на каждой строчке по цифре. Далее я хочу считать эти цифры из файла в переменную:
C++
1
2
int key;
In >> key;
Вроде всё правильно и всё должно работать - но ничего не работает. Когда идёт открытие файла - In обновляется и в его параметрах мусор исчезает и становятся нули. Дальше соответственно ничего не работает. Точнее работает но в кей ничего не пишется.
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
04.12.2014, 22:45
Ответы с готовыми решениями:

не могу открыть файл через ifstream
std::string path = "text.txt"; // путь к файлу(находится в папке с проектом) std::ifstream...

Не могу открыть WMware через VS, не видит wmx файл
Добрый день, в visual studio 2012 пишу консольное приложение, которое должно открывать виртуальную...

Как открыть файл через иную программу через батник
Допустим хочу запустить таблицу Cheat Engine которая в формате .CT, но если открыть через батник,...

Через Ексель Открыть файл ВОРД и сохранить файл под определенным именем
Открываю через ексель файлы ворд и выполняю макрос ворд, но не получается сохранить файл под...

2
шКодер самоучка
2227 / 1921 / 927
Регистрация: 09.10.2013
Сообщений: 4,262
Записей в блоге: 7
04.12.2014, 22:47 2
Gudsaf, расширение файла забыли указать в аргументе вызова
1
104 / 15 / 3
Регистрация: 29.11.2010
Сообщений: 335
04.12.2014, 22:57  [ТС] 3
Цитата Сообщение от Cra3y Посмотреть сообщение
Gudsaf, расширение файла забыли указать в аргументе вызова
Спасибо, буду знать!
0
04.12.2014, 22:57
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
04.12.2014, 22:57
Помогаю со студенческими работами здесь

Не могу открыть файл
Рисовал, сохранил файл (формат TIF), выключил принудительно комп, позже включаю, а файл не могу...

Не могу открыть файл
Не могу открыть файл, сразу же выдаёт ошибку: >>> f = open('F:\python\py\1.txt') Traceback...

Не могу открыть файл
procedure TForm1.N5Click(Sender: TObject); begin memo1.Lines.LoadFromFile(n5.Caption); end;...

Не могу открыть файл
http://exponenta.ru/educat/referat/XIIkonkurs/9/index.asp Не могу открыть этот файл Ребят...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
3
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ru